Cultural Bonding- Harvest Festival at Consolata Shrine, Nairobi, Kenya.
September 30, 2017, Konkani speaking Catholic Christians having their origin in Konkan Coast of Karnataka,(KKCN) India, together with members of Mangalorean Cultural association, both small and informal groups came together to celebrate Harvest Festival at Consolata Shrine Nairobi.
About 200 people, from different backgrounds, faith and beliefs were brought together through their strong cultural background as one family to celebrate a festival known by different names like Hosa Akki Oota, Kural Porba, Monti Festh etc. similar to other festivals celebrated throughout India during the month of September.
The festival is also known as family feast is celebrated, together with entire family and friends. It involves blessing of the crop, (Paddy Stalks used back home , whereas we used here Maize Corn) and partaking in Strictly vegetarian meal (with odd number of vegetarian dishes) together with the consumption of a sweet dish mixed with blessed corn/rice signifying our unity and family bond.
The program started with singing of devotional songs, showering of flowers around 2.8 meters tall statue of Our Lady of Consolata, which was manufactured in Mangalaore, followed by speeches and reflections on the feast by Mr.Michael Sequeira, Chairman of KKKCN, who reflected on the importance of celebrating the feast as one community, then by Mr.Sriram Phadke, Chairman of Mangalorean Cultural association (MCA) who also dwelt further on the cultural as well as religious significance of the feast. Mr Ravi Putran, Chairman of Karnataka Cultural Association and also member of MCA in his remarks stated that the harvest Festival is not only expressing gratitude to mother earth for providing food but also to remind us to take care of Mother Earth and our environment.
Fr.Francis Rodrigues, the main speaker stressed the importance of our unity, in that he said, we may Call our mother by different names, may be Laxmi, Durga or Mother Mary, but Mother is One irrespective the names. He further drew analogy between our biological mother and Mother nature, where both of them continue providing unceasingly, may be food, protection, love, comfort etc.
Fr.Daniel Bertea IMC, Parish Priest Consolata Shrine present on the occasion also spoke and appreciated the cultural and religious harmony practiced by the community. Mr.Wilson D’souza compered the program and Mr.Basil Serrao proposed vote of Thanks.
The traditional food was prepared by Lady members of the community together with the support from Chaupaty and Open House Restaurants.
